(B站云e办)SpringBoot开发项目实战记录(六)附加一个获取security的全局用户获取工具类一、管理员crud1.1 获取除了登录用户以外的符合条件的管理员1. pojo层2. controller层3. service层4. mapper层的xml1.2 更新管理员信息1. pojo层加个注解 @Getter(AccessLevel.NONE)2. controller层1.3 删
## 如何在Java中实现API密钥管理
在当今的开发环境中,API密钥(apiKey)的使用变得越来越普遍,它们是认证客户端和API服务之间通信的重要凭证。本篇文章将一步步教你如何在Java中实现API密钥的管理。首先,我们将梳理整个流程,然后逐步讲解代码实现。
### 流程概述
我们将根据以下步骤来实现API密钥的管理:
| 步骤 | 描述
原创
2024-08-26 06:08:47
72阅读
## Kubernetes API Key简介与使用
Kubernetes是一个开源的容器编排平台,用于自动化部署、扩展和管理容器化应用程序。使用API Key可以方便地对Kubernetes集群进行身份验证和授权,以便在应用程序中访问Kubernetes API。
### 什么是Kubernetes API Key?
Kubernetes API Key是一种用于身份验证的凭证,允许应用程
原创
2024-03-02 06:59:31
60阅读
deepseek apikey 是一项用于访问 DeepSeek API 的密钥,通常会在集成或使用该 API 时遇到相应的问题。本文将详细记录解决“deepseek apikey”相关问题的整个过程,包括备份策略、恢复流程、灾难场景、工具链集成、预防措施和监控告警等内容。
## 备份策略
有效的备份策略是确保重要数据持久性和安全性的关键。我们将采用甘特图展现备份周期计划,储存介质选择也将影响
# 实现Java API密钥的步骤
作为一名经验丰富的开发者,我将向你介绍如何实现Java API密钥。下面是整个过程的步骤表格:
| 步骤 | 描述 |
| --- | --- |
| 1 | 创建一个密钥管理类 |
| 2 | 生成一个随机密钥 |
| 3 | 将密钥保存到数据库或配置文件中 |
| 4 | 在API请求中验证密钥 |
## 步骤1:创建一个密钥管理类
首先,我们需要创
原创
2024-01-03 04:34:55
155阅读
1.什么是kafka? Kafka是一个分布式的基于发布/订阅模式的消息队列(Message Queue),主要应用于大数据实时处理领域。 2.消息队列2.1 使用消息队列的好处 1)解耦允许你独立的扩展或修改两边的处理过程,只要确保它们遵守同样的接口约束。 2)可恢复性系统的一部
转载
2024-03-26 21:22:05
45阅读
文章目录9.1 消息中间件MQ9.2 Kafka 是什么9.3 Kafka 架构9.4 为什么一个 Topic 要分成多个 Partition9.5 Kafka 如何处理旧数据9.5 副本同步9.6 Kafka 容灾9.7 Zookeeper 在 Kafka 中的作用 9.1 消息中间件MQ什么是消息中间件:消息中间件关注数据的发送和接收,主要解决的是分布式系统之间的消息传递问题。通过提供 消息
转载
2024-08-07 08:34:57
63阅读
kafka是一个分布式消息队列。具有高性能、持久化、多副本备份、横向扩展能力。生产者往队列里写消息,消费者从队列里取消息进行业务逻辑。一般在架构设计中起到解耦、削峰、异步处理的作用。kafka对外使用topic的概念,生产者往topic里写消息,消费者从读消息。为了做到水平扩展,一个topic实际是由多个partition组成的,遇到瓶颈时,可以通过增加partition的数量来进行横向扩容。单个
转载
2024-02-26 13:30:55
192阅读
1-Kafka定义&作用Kafka 是一种高吞吐量的分布式发布订阅消息系统,用于数据的缓冲。具有高吞吐、可持久化、可水平扩展、支持流数据处理等多种特性。作用一:消息系统。具备冗余存储、缓冲、异步通信、扩展性、可恢复性等功能。作用二:存储系统:Kafka有消息持久化和多副本机制。将消息持久化到磁盘,可以把它作为长期的数据存储系统来使用作用三:流式处理平台。Kafka 可以和流式处理框架进行集
转载
2024-03-29 11:19:51
185阅读
10、消费者分区分配策略:什么是消费者组?Consumer Group 是 Kafka 提供的可扩展且具有容错性的消费者机制。组内有多个消费者或者消费实例,它们共享一个ID,称为group ID。Consumer Group 下可以有一个或多个 Consumer 实例。这里的实例可以是一个单独的进程,也可以是同一进程下的线程。在实际场景中,使用进程更为常见一些。Group ID 是一个字符串,在一
转载
2024-02-26 21:30:49
1773阅读
1. KAFKA 简介kafka:基于发布订阅模式的消息队列kafka优点:削峰,解耦,高并发,高性能,可热拓展。2. zookeeper & Kafka安装版本信息zookeeperscala:2.11kafka:0.11安装步骤下载Scala以及Kafka压缩包复制到虚拟主机指定文件夹下并执行解压操作# 先安装Scala
tar -zxvf scala-2.11.6.tgz
# 重命名
转载
2024-06-05 20:40:27
65阅读
1. 首先先要获取你的debug keystore位置: 打开Eclipse--->Windows--->Preferences--->Android--->Build查看默认的debug keystore位置,我的是C:\Documents and Settings\MYNAME \.android\debug.keystore 2. 在cmd中执行:keytool -l
转载
2010-01-17 19:02:00
97阅读
2评论
原创:石头哥@大数据架构师 2021年8月2日 微信:nevian668899概念和作用1、Kafka Controller是Kakfa服务端Broker的概念,Broker集群有多台,但只有一台Broker可以扮演控制器的角色;2、某台Broker一旦成为Controller,它用于以下权力:完成对集群成员管理、主题维护和分区的管理,如集群broker信息、T
原创
精选
2022-01-15 23:36:25
2085阅读
# Java提交API Key认证流程
## 1. 概述
在开发中,我们经常会遇到需要对API进行认证的情况。其中一种常见的认证方式是使用API Key(密钥)进行认证。本文将讲解如何在Java中实现API Key认证。
## 2. 流程图
```mermaid
erDiagram
Developer --> API: 请求API
API --> Developer: 返回
原创
2023-10-18 07:01:32
290阅读
要获取淘宝、京东、拼多多、1688商品详情、发货时间、优惠券等数据,可以通过淘宝的API接口来实现。以下是一个简单的接入示例:注册一个api账号并获取Api Key和Api Secret。使用淘宝的API接口,如taobao.item.get(获取单个商品的详细信息)和taobao.shop.get(获取店铺信息)等。使用HTTP客户端(如Python的requests库)发送
一、前言用户通常需要注册API KEY或者其他验证方法,才能使用你的服务,一般我们会用到一下集中验证方式API KeysBasic AuthHMACOAuth身份验证:指证明正确的身份,授权: 允许的动作API可能会对您进行身份验证,但未授权您发出特定的请求API缺乏安全性的后果为什么API需要身份验证,API没有安全性,用户可以任意注册即可无限次访问和调用API,且没有请求与特定用户数据关联的简
转载
2024-05-08 15:55:13
865阅读
上一篇博客中,我们初步了解了Kafka实质上是一个消息队列,具有异步、解耦、削峰的作用并且在mac环境下安装了Kafka相关环境,具体可以参考Kafka学习笔记(一):Kafka简介与mac下的环境配置。今天我们将以实战的方式深入理解 Kafka 集群的基本组件和专有术语 broker、topic、producer、consumer、partition等。从上节课的实验,我们了解了 Kafka 的
转载
2024-02-20 18:40:01
48阅读
Zookeeper 概述 Zookeeper是一个开源的分布式服务管理框架。存储业务服务节点元数据及状态信息,并负责通知再 ZooKeeper 上注册的服务几点状态给客户端 Zookeeper 工作机制 Zookeeper从设计模式角度来理解: 是一个基
转载
2024-06-06 15:05:12
43阅读
Kafka启动都会创建KafkaController,然后会向zookeeper注册,第一个注册的节点就是Leader,其余都是follower。当KafkaController出现故障,不能继续管理集群,则那些KafkaController follower开始竞争成为新的LeaderKafkaController的启动过程是在startup方法中完成的:首先:注册一个SessionExpira
转载
2024-03-20 11:02:49
75阅读
1. controller 选举每个kafka集群里的controller在某一个时刻只能由一个Broker担任,这个Broker是由集群里的所有Broker选举出来的, 随着时间的推移,Controller可能易主。选举原理: 选举时,每个Broker都尝试向zookeeper写入/controller,但只能有一个Broker成功,这个Broker节点就是Controller所在的节点,同时每
转载
2024-03-27 11:08:46
35阅读